Join your host, Terence Williams, with a perfect introduction to Cambridge for first-time visitors. This episode covers six essential stops that capture the city’s history, beauty, and atmosphere — without trying to do too much.

Places featured:

King’s College Chapel

Highlights: One of the most iconic sights in the UK. Stunning architecture, history, and an instant sense of Cambridge’s academic heritage.

The Backs

Highlights: The postcard view of Cambridge — college lawns, bridges, punts, and peaceful riverside paths.

Market Square

Highlights: The heart of the city centre. Street food, local produce, and a great place to get your bearings.

Fitzwilliam Museum

Highlights: Free, world-class collections and an easy cultural win for visitors.

Scudamore’s Punting Company

Highlights: The quintessential Cambridge experience — seeing the city from the river.

Fitzbillies

Highlights: Finish your visit with a Chelsea bun and coffee — a simple, classic Cambridge tradition.
